+kennythekiwi Posted July 17, 2015 Share Posted July 17, 2015 Hi, I compile a partially complete project and I get a .GWC file then rename it so it becomes a zip file. The zip file now won't open because it's invalid. Any ideas? TIA Kenny Quote Link to comment
+charlenni Posted July 17, 2015 Share Posted July 17, 2015 A GWZ file is a ZIP file, a GWC isn't. You couldn't open it by normal tools. Quote Link to comment
Ranger Fox Posted July 17, 2015 Share Posted July 17, 2015 To expound upon charlenni's post: A GWZ is a zip file created by zipping the lua cartridge file and all resources (e.g. images) used within the cartridge, then changing the file extension. A GWC is a file created by feeding the GWZ file through a compiler, which takes the zipped lua file and creates machine code from it, appending all images' bytes after the compiled lua code. You can't get a GWZ by renaming a GWC. (And the GWZ does not need the GWC included with it.) You can think of it this way: a GWZ is zipped and a GWC is compiled (or the cartridge itself). I don't know what you're doing, but I suspect you might be trying to upload a GWZ to the cartridge listing service site (Wherigo.com). Just zip the lua and images you have and you'll be fine.
